I can’t say that I completely agree that your color palette is as unified as my own shot at this: >>247066 The dress colors still feel very different from Luna and probably isn’t complementing her colors that well.
I think your grays are too neutral. While they aren’t clashingly warm or saturated as the original, my own coloring attempt changed the red-violet to something much cooler in color temperature. I also turned the color scheme to be something more of an analogous sort (blues, indigo’s, violets).
There is also the issue of the gold attracting more attention to themselves (even worse as Luna’s colors are all dark), My color edit changed them to be silver, something much more neutral and doesn’t attract too much attention to themselves.
But, there’s probably more to this black and gold color palette that I’m overlooking, but who knows. I guess I just approached this differently.
